Understanding Morphology in Language Models
Morphology involves analyzing how words are formed from smaller units called morphemes, which include roots, prefixes, and suffixes. For AI models, understanding these components helps in grasping the meaning and function of words, even when they are complex or unfamiliar.
Importance of Morphology in AI Development
Incorporating morphological analysis into AI language models offers several advantages:
- Improved Vocabulary Handling: Morphology allows models to recognize related words and infer meanings, expanding their vocabulary without explicit training on every word.
- Enhanced Language Understanding: It helps in understanding nuanced language features like tense, number, and case, which are often conveyed through morphological changes.
- Better Morphological Segmentation: This enables models to break down complex words into manageable parts, facilitating more accurate translation and generation.
Challenges and Future Directions
Despite its benefits, integrating morphology into AI models presents challenges. Morphological rules can vary significantly across languages, requiring models to adapt to different linguistic structures. Additionally, some languages have complex morphology that is difficult to encode computationally.
Future research aims to develop more sophisticated morphological analyzers and incorporate deep learning techniques to better understand language structures. This will enhance the ability of AI models to process languages with rich morphological systems, making them more versatile and accurate.
